简介:
随着人工智能技术的不断发展,越来越多的企业和个人开始意识到AI应用的重要性。而ChatGPT作为OpenAI公司推出的一款自然语言处理领域的大型预训练模型,受到了广泛的关注。许多人都想要在自己的网站上部署一个ChatGPT模型,以提高用户体验和网站的智能化水平。不过,由于服务器的成本较高,很多企业和个人可能无法承担这个费用。
幸运的是,现在有一些公司提供免费的服务器资源,让用户可以部署自己的ChatGPT网页版,并且提供1年的免费使用期限。这意味着,在1年内,你可以免费地使用该服务器来运行你的ChatGPT网页版应用,而无需支付任何费用。
部署一个ChatGPT网页版需要一定的技术知识和技能。首先,你需要有一个服务器,并需要在该服务器上安装必要的软件和环境。然后,你需要将ChatGPT模型上传到服务器上,并编写网页代码来实现与模型的交互。最后,你需要将网页代码部署到服务器上,使得用户可以通过互联网访问你的网页。
在这个过程中,选择一个好的服务器供应商非常重要。首先,你需要考虑服务器的性能和稳定性。由于ChatGPT模型需要大量的计算资源来进行推理,因此你需要选择一个性能较强的服务器,以保证模型的正常运行。此外,你还需要考虑服务器的网络速度和稳定性,以保证用户可以快速地访问你的网页。
其次,你需要考虑服务器的安全性。由于ChatGPT模型涉及用户的隐私和数据安全,因此你需要选择一个安全可靠的服务器供应商,以保证你的应用不会被黑客攻击或泄露用户数据。
最后,你需要考虑服务器的成本。虽然有些公司提供免费的服务器资源,但是这些资源往往有一定的限制和期限。如果你需要更高级的服务器或者需要更长时间的免费使用期限,你可能需要支付一定的费用。因此,在选择服务器供应商时,你需要根据自己的需求和预算进行综合考虑。
可以以文心一言为例
API 的调用流程如下图所示。

(1)登录百度智能云千帆控制台。
请您注册并登录百度智能云千帆控制台 。
注意:为保障服务稳定运行,账户最好不处于欠费状态。
(2)创建千帆应用
进入控制台创建应用 。如果已有应用,此步骤可跳过。
(3)创建应用后,获取AppID、API Key、Secret Key。

应用创建成功后,千帆平台默认为应用开通所有API调用权限,无需申请授权。
注意:针对付费服务,如果用户在使用过程中,操作了终止付费,则无法调用对应的API。如需重新开通,请在千帆大模型平台-在线服务页面,点击开通付费。

根据步骤一获取的API Key、Secret Key,获取access_token。参考以下获取access_token,更多详情方法请参考获取access_token。
注意:access_token默认有效期30天,生产环境注意及时刷新。
```bash label=bash# 填充API Key与Secret Keycurl 'https://aip.baidubce.com/oauth/2.0/token?grant_type=client_credentials&client_id=【API Key】&client_secret=【Secret Key】'``````Python label=Python# 填充API Key与Secret Keyimport requestsimport jsondef main():url = "https://aip.baidubce.com/oauth/2.0/token?client_id=【API Key】&client_secret=【Secret Key】&grant_type=client_credentials"payload = json.dumps("")headers = {'Content-Type': 'application/json','Accept': 'application/json'}response = requests.request("POST", url, headers=headers, data=payload)return response.json().get("access_token")if __name__ == '__main__':access_token = main()print(access_token)```
调用千帆提供的相关接口,如ERNIE-Bot等,详见API列表。